Let's talk about the role and responsibilities:

  • Looks for opportunities and implements solutions to improve, streamline, and automate legal operations, as well as simplify workflows and create efficiencies for our growing legal team. 
  • Owns the management of legal systems, tools, and processes, including knowledge, contract, and compliance management systems.
  • Serves as one of the front-line legal contacts for certain business groups, such as sales and operations, and builds an effective relationship with those groups to ensure the ability to determine how to triage their legal needs quickly and efficiently.
  • Develops and executes our communication plans, playbooks, guidelines, and policies for company-wide and department-specific legal initiatives.
  • Creates training materials and self-service tools for sales, operations, and other internal clients Identify, manage, and report on key operational metrics for the legal team that will better inform decision-making, department roadmaps, budgeting, and hiring plans.
  • Works with attorneys to provide legal advice on a broad range of topics such as licensing, general commercial law, policy guidance, privacy, data security, contract interpretation, and vendor relationships.
  • Reviews, drafts, and negotiates NDAs, SOWs, RFPs, technology agreements, amendments, and other documents related to agreements with our customers and vendors.
  • Works closely with internal stakeholders (including Sales, Customer Support, Consulting, and Finance teams) to ensure alignment between business needs and contract terms.
  • Triaging document flow to manage feedback from required parties and managing prioritization.
  • Collaborating on contract feedback with external counsel, internal departments, and key stakeholders to keep the process moving and keep parties informed.
  • Assist with scheduling of meetings with external constituents.
  • Manage contract completion including routing for e-signature and following up on outstanding documents.
  • Maintaining a contracts repository so that in process and completed work is easily accessible to the appropriate parties.
  • Advising internal departments on process improvement.
  • Look for opportunities to improve the contracting process.

Let’s talk about your skills/expertise: 

  • Minimum 3 years of prior experience as a paralegal, contracts manager, contracts administrator, or other comparable role.
  • Deep understanding of contract review, drafting and negotiation process for various types of commercial contracts, including NDAs, technology agreements, service agreements, DPAs, etc.
  • Solid understanding of legal project management, including analyzing and building processes and automating manual tasks with technology solutions.
  • Demonstrated ability to independently move projects forward by gaining the support needed from others while working in a cross-functional role.
  • Experience in developing, implementing, and using technology solutions or other contract/matter management software, DocuSign, Salesforce, IronClad.
  • Strategic problem-solver who focuses on how our legal operations can positively impact the business and our customers.
  • Commitment to providing timely and appropriate business advice/guidance to internal clients.
  • Demonstrate strong skills in negotiations, problem solving, verbal and written communications, and task management and prioritization.
  • Process-oriented, organized, and have amazing attention to detail.
  • Enjoy working independently and as a team member while solving complex and interesting challenges.
  • Corporate in-house experience, preferably at a SaaS or technology organization.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Good time-management skills.
  • Ability to perform under pressure.
  • Excellent computer skills.
  • A keen eye for detail.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
